mfg date vs. original activation date ?

I have a PPC 6700 that has a broken screen. When i went into look at the mfg date for warrenty information i found that the Refurbishment status is "No" the MFG Date is "5-1-2006" and the Original Activation Date is "2-1-06".

How can the mfg date be after the activation date?

found this out: Originally Posted by DocsNotary
I've had my replacement 6700 for a week and a half now, and there is some weirdness going on that I don't understand.

First of all, I was disappointed when I received it to realize that the manufacture date reported using ##RTN# was 4/10/2006, suggesting that I won't be able to restore the ring through Ev-DO behavior. However, that same screen shows the "original activation date" as 2/1/2006. How can it have been originally activated before it was manufactured? I wonder if there is any use trying the hack to see if it works despite the reported date of manufacture making it apparently ineligible.


When you first turn on your phone and set it up, the phone by default is set to date as 2/1/2006, hence that's why it shows up as the activation date. It happened to me as well -- the Sprint Store agent set the phone up and gave it to me, and it showed 2/1/2006 as the date.
